Output 2baf4ebc538e1e943bbd409be5a9481e5dc643103e7e1701195468b2d7a086f2:7

value
59011114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0998aecb30bc85aea0bbf5c2b82274f6c2bde38 OP_EQUAL
address
3GLByZwDGT59VUphqUiMWzSz35TU5LD371
transaction
2baf4ebc538e1e943bbd409be5a9481e5dc643103e7e1701195468b2d7a086f2
spent
true